    For a many2many field, a list of tuples is expected. Here is the list of tuple that are accepted, with the corresponding semantics:

    (0, 0,  { values })    link to a new record that needs to be created with the given values dictionary
    (1, ID, { values })    update the linked record with id = ID (write *values* on it)
    (2, ID)                remove and delete the linked record with id = ID (calls unlink on ID, that will delete the object completely, and the link to it as well)
    (3, ID)                cut the link to the linked record with id = ID (delete the relationship between the two objects but does not delete the target object itself)
    (4, ID)                link to existing record with id = ID (adds a relationship)
    (5)                    unlink all (like using (3,ID) for all linked records)
    (6, 0, [IDs])          replace the list of linked IDs (like using (5) then (4,ID) for each ID in the list of IDs)
    
    Example:
    [(6, 0, [8, 5, 6, 4])] sets the many2many to ids [8, 5, 6, 4]
    

    For a one2many field, a list of tuples is expected. Here is the list of tuple that are accepted, with the corresponding semantics:

    (0, 0,  { values })    link to a new record that needs to be created with the given values dictionary
    (1, ID, { values })    update the linked record with id = ID (write *values* on it)
    (2, ID)                remove and delete the linked record with id = ID (calls unlink on ID, that will delete the object completely, and the link to it as well)
    
    Example:
    [(0, 0, {'field_name':field_value_record1, ...}), (0, 0, {'field_name':field_value_record2, ...})]
